Uhuru at JKIA as Lucy Kibaki’s body arrives in Nairobi


Former First Lady Lucy Kibaki’s body has arrived in Nairobi.

Mrs Kibaki’s body was on a Kenya Airways flight from London which arrived at the Jomo Kenyatta International Airport at about 5 am.

Also on the flight were retired President Kibaki and other family and friends who had accompanied Mrs Kibaki to London, where she died last Tuesday.

The casket bearing Mrs Kibaki’s body was lowered from the Dreamliner at about 6.10am and taken by a team of pallbearers selected from the army, navy and air force.

It was draped in the Kenyan flag.

The State House choir coloured the sombre proceedings with a selection of songs, striking up the dirge ‘It is well with my soul‘ as the team of men and women from the military marched on the red carpet and placed the casket under a gazebo.

At hand to receive the delegation from London were President Kenyatta, First Lady Margaret Kenyatta and Cabinet Secretaries as well as current and former MPs.

Prayers were said by Fr Dominic Wamugunda. He read from the book of Wisdom.

The body will be kept at Lee Funeral Home as preparations for the funeral continue.
